What is a Navy Federal Routing Number?
A Navy Federal routing number, also known as an American Bankers Association (ABA) routing number, is a 9-digit code that identifies a financial institution and facilitates the transfer of funds between banks. This number is essential for direct deposit, online bill payments, and other electronic transactions. 3 Easy Steps to Find Your Navy Federal Routing Number
Finding your Navy Federal routing number in 3 easy steps is a straightforward process:
Step 1: Log in to your Navy Federal online account
To find your routing number, you'll need to log in to your Navy Federal online account. This will grant you access to your account information, including your routing number.
Step 2: Navigate to the account settings or help section
Once you're logged in, navigate to the account settings or help section of your online account. This is usually where you'll find your routing number listed.
Step 3: Find your routing number
Look for your Navy Federal routing number in the account settings or help section. You may need to click on a specific link or button to access the information. If you're still having trouble finding your routing number, you can contact Navy Federal's customer support for assistance.
